Tools of Geometry
Basic Geometry
Term | Definition |
---|---|
Angle | Two rays that share the same starting point. |
Line | A set of connected points that extends forever in two directions. |
Ray | A portion of a line that as one starting point and extends forever in one direction. |
Line Segment | A portion of a line that has one starting point and one ending point. |
Acute Angle | An angle that measures more than 0 degrees but less than 90 degrees. |
Obtuse Angle | An angle that measures more than 90 degrees but less than 180 degrees. |
Right Angle | An angle that measures exactly 90 degrees. |
Straight Angle | An angle that measure exactly 180 degrees. |
Adjacent Angles | Angles that are next to each other and share a common side and a common vertex. |
Complementary Angles | Two angles that add to 90 degrees. |
Supplementary Angles | Two angles that add to 180 degrees. |
Vertical Angles | Formed by pairs of intersecting lines and are across from each other. They are congruent (equal). |
